Answer:
f. the sequence goes by the half of the previous number.
= 16, 8, 4, 2, 1, 1/2, 1/4, 1/8...
g. the sequence goes by adding the consecutive odd number added to the previous number.
first number= 3.
second number= 3+3
= 6
third number= 6+5
= 11
fourth number= 11+7
= 18
fifth number= 18+9
= 27
sixth number= 27+11
= 38
seventh number= 38+13
= 51, etc.
= 3, 6, 11, 18, 27, 38, 51...
